Rare: 50 - 60°C; Medium: 60 - 70°C; Well done: 70 - 80°C

The roasting temperatures and times given in the chart should be adequate for most joints, but slight adjustments may be required to allow for personal requirements and the shape and texture of the meat. However, lower temperatures and longer cooking times are recommended for less tender cuts or larger joints.

Wrap joints in foil if preferred, for extra browning uncover for the last 20 - 30 min. cooking time. If you cover the food with foil or lid allow an extra 10-15 minutes for each ½kg (1lb)

Care and cleaning

Warning! Before cleaning always allow the appliance to cool down before switching off at the electricity supply.

Cleaning materials

Before using any cleaning materials on your appliance, check that they are suitable and that their use is recommended by the man- ufacturer.

Cleaners that contain bleach should NOT be used as they may dull the surface finishes. Harsh abrasives and scourers should also be avoided.

Multi-surface antibacterial cleaning products should not be used on the ceramic hob or on the surrounding trims.

Cleaning the outside of the appliance

Do not use abrasive cleaning materials or scourers on painted or printed finishes as damage may occur.

Regularly wipe over the control panel, doors and appliance sides using a soft cloth and hot soapy water.

To prevent streaking finish with a soft cloth. Stainless Steel cream cleaners are abrasive and should be avoided as they may dull the surface finish.

Any spillage on the stainless steel finish must be wiped off immediately.

Warning! Do not attempt to remove any of the control knobs from the appliance as this may cause damage and is a safety hazard.

Cleaning the control knobs and handles

It is strongly recommended that only hot soapy water is used for cleaning the control knobs and handles.

ANY OTHER CLEANING MATERIALS MAY DULL THE SURFACE FINISH.

Removing and replacing the wire work runners

1.Remove all shelves and furniture from the oven.

2.Hold the wire work at the bottom, unclip from the cavity side and gently pull to- wards the centre of the oven.

3.Unhook the runner at the top and re- move from the cavi- ty.

4.To replace the run- ners, hook the wire work side runner into the cavity, slide back and press into place.

Warning! Ensure

the wirework runners are firmly in position before replacing the oven shelves.

Cleaning the gas hob

Clean the hotplate top using a mild abrasive. Take care not to damage the spark electro- des. If the spark electrodes are damaged the burners will not light.

You can remove the pan supports, burner caps and burner crowns to clean them. Again take care not to damage the spark electrodes.

Clean the burner crowns and pan supports by soaking them in very hot soapy water. Aluminium based saucepans can leave shiny metal marks on the pan supports.

You can remove any stubborn stains by scouring with a soap impregnated steel wool pad.
